Transaction 83aed0e124ce78e0e5ffc34e0c01ae4003a8c8ac718f7ac816fa1710fdb6ce24
1 Input
1 Output
-
83aed0e124ce78e0e5ffc34e0c01ae4003a8c8ac718f7ac816fa1710fdb6ce24:0
- value
- 74054651
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43365e4c94b192d0bb80f1e971a5fa1573265765 OP_EQUALVERIFY OP_CHECKSIG
- address
- 178PQS54KWTxe6wT7ucqgC1zb3LWKAGRDq